Science is fun…

Join us for the Mad Scientist Horticulture Club hosted at the Will County Extension Office (100 Manhattan Rd Joliet, IL 60433). 

Sessions will start at 9am and last approximately 1- 1.5 hours

Dates and Session Topics: 

June17th: Living Mad Scientist 

Participants will learn about the term “horticulture” and horticulture careers. They will also make a living mad scientist (grass heads).

June 24th: Plant Maze Part 1 

Learn about what plant’s need to grow and design your own plant maze for the plants to grow through. 

July 15th: Plant Maze Part 2

Construct your plant maze based off of your designs.

July 22nd: Wacky Worms 

Learn about vermiculture (worm composting) and set up your own worm compost bin. 

July 29th: Ecosystems in a Jar

Study aquatic food chains, fishing stock rates, creel and size limits used by Fish Biologists to manage largemouth bass populations. Learn how the eye of a bass works and why water clarity effect largemouth bass behavior

August 5th: Observations and Edible Soil

Look over all of the observations you made throughout the program, and compare your results with partners. Learn about the layers of the Earth through edible soil cups.
